    Serial Communication Control Under normal working condition, the camera could be controlled through RS232 interface. RS232 serial parameters are as below: • Baud rate: 2400/4800/9600/115200bps; • Start bit: 1; data bits: 8; Stop bit: 1; Parity: None. Pan-Tilt function rotates the camera to its maximum position of top left upon startup, then it returns to the center, and the process of initialization is finished.

    Network Connection Connecting Mode Direct connection: Connect the camera and computer directly via Ethernet cable. IP connection mode: Connect the camera to a Router or Switcher. The user can log in to access the device using browser. Note: Please do not put the power cable and Ethernet cable in places where can be easily touched to prevent video quality loss caused by unstable signal transmission.
